Description
Grandma’s Hash Brown Casserole is a classic comfort food favorite. Crispy, cheesy, and creamy, this casserole combines thawed hash browns with cream of chicken soup, sour cream, cheddar cheese, and butter, then topped with a crunchy cornflake or cracker topping for a golden finish. Ingredients
- 1 bag (30 oz / 850 g) frozen shredded hash browns, thawed
- 1 can (10.5 oz / 300 g) cream of chicken soup
- 1 cup (240 ml) sour cream
- 2 cups (200 g) shredded cheddar cheese, divided
- ½ cup (115 g) melted butter
- ½ cup (80 g) finely chopped onion
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
- 1 ½ cups (75 g) crushed cornflakes or buttery crackers (for topping)
- 3 tablespoons melted butter (for topping)
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×13-inch baking dish.
- In a large bowl, combine thawed hash browns, cream of chicken soup, sour cream, 1 ½ cups of shredded cheddar cheese, melted butter, chopped onion,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per. Mix until well combined.
- Spread mixture evenly in the prepared baking dish.
- In a small bowl, mix crushed cornflakes or crackers with 3 tablespoons melted butter and remaining ½ cup shredded cheddar cheese. Sprinkle evenly over the top of the casserole.
- Bake for 45-50 minutes until bubbly and golden brown on top.
- Let cool slightly before serving. Enjoy warm.
Notes
- Use day-old or thawed frozen hash browns for best texture.
- For extra flavor, add diced cooked bacon or a pinch of paprika.
- Leftovers can be refrigerated for up to 3 days and reheated in the oven.
